Abstract

The invention discloses a water curtain dust removal device for mechanically processing dust, comprising a water curtain air box, a fan and a filtering water tank. The water curtain air box is provided with an air extraction channel and a water curtain channel, the fan drives the air extraction, and the outer end of the water curtain air box is provided with a The air inlet is connected with the air extraction channel. The water curtain channel is connected to the water inlet pipe and connected to the filter water tank. The filter water tank is equipped with a water pump. The water pump pressurized water flows through the water inlet pipe and the water curtain channel to form a flowing water curtain. At the section end between the channels, the lower end of the air-inducing channel is provided with a drain pipe which is connected to the filtered water tank. The product of the present invention designs a water curtain dust removal device that can be installed in the existing mechanical processing equipment for dust removal. The dust generated by the mechanical processing is extracted by the fan to extract the dust generated by the mechanical processing through the water curtain mixing and dust removal, and then the humid exhaust gas is mixed again by the circulating air silo. Collect dust and discharge the exhaust gas into the dust removal cycle to avoid exhaust gas emission.

Technical field
The present invention relates to machining equipment technical field, the dust collector of water curtain of specifically a kind of machining dust.
Background technique
In existing machining for workpiece surface processing such as polishing, grinding process technical process can all generate largely Metallic dust pollution, these metallized metal dust do not pass through the processing of cleaner, not only greatly polluted operation ring Border affects the health of staff, can also generate explosion because of the accumulation of dust, there is great security risks.
Existing polishing machine, grinding machine equipment also have the mode of setting blower dust suction dedusting to handle a large amount of dust of generation, But only simple blower is detached and is deposited in disposal box, processing can then be generated by failing to clear up disposal box in time in operator Mars in the process ignite entire disposal box or even whole equipment the case where, however it remains biggish security risk, A kind of setting recirculated water is disclosed in the Chinese invention patent " a kind of water-bath type from dedusting sanding and polishing machine " of CN205542534U Bath water case area, realizes the processing of polishing machine dust in a manner of circulator bath, and the dedusting method using water and dust structure makes powder Dirt can be effectively treated, but it uses in entire polishing machine and is largely designed with the structure of water, has for polishing machine overall structure Biggish change, cost are also related to higher, and conventional polishing equipment is low-cost equipment, and high cost, which is improved, to be increased The production cost of enterprise is added, and has polished machine operation and be switched on operation, has easily generated because water flow overflows the electric shock thing generated Therefore.
